Why Digestive Enzyme Supplements for No Gallbladder Is Necessary
When I had my gallbladder removed, I quickly realized that my digestion did not feel the same. My body used to release bile in a more controlled way to help break down fats, but without a gallbladder, that process became less efficient for me. I noticed that heavier meals, especially those with fat, could leave me feeling bloated, uncomfortable, or sluggish. That is why digestive enzyme supplements became important in my routine—they helped support the breakdown of food when my own digestion felt weaker.
I also found that digestive enzyme supplements can make meals easier to handle by helping my body digest proteins, fats, and carbohydrates more smoothly. Without enough support, I sometimes experienced gas, fullness, or loose stools after eating. Adding enzymes gave me more confidence to eat without constantly worrying about discomfort afterward. For me, it was not about replacing my body’s natural function, but about giving it extra help during a time when it needed support.
Most importantly, digestive enzyme supplements helped me feel more balanced and comfortable after meals. Since living without a gallbladder can change the way food is processed, I learned that supporting digestion can make a big difference in daily life.

1. I Look for Bile Support, Not Just Basic Enzymes
Since I don’t have a gallbladder, my body doesn’t release bile in the same stored, concentrated way. That’s why I pay attention to supplements that include bile salts or ox bile along with digestive enzymes. For me, this combination often works better than standard enzyme blends alone, especially when I eat meals that contain fat.
2. I Check for a Full Enzyme Blend
I prefer products that include multiple enzymes instead of just one or two. The most helpful ones for me usually include:
- Lipase for fats
- Protease for proteins
- Amylase for carbohydrates
- Cellulase for plant fibers
The more balanced the blend, the more likely it is to help me with different kinds of meals.
3. I Pay Attention to Strength and Dosage
I’ve learned that not all supplements are equally potent. I compare enzyme activity units, not just the ingredient list. A product may sound impressive, but if the dosage is too low, I may not notice much benefit. I usually start with a moderate dose and see how my body responds before increasing it.
4. I Prefer Gentle Formulas
After gallbladder removal, my digestion can be sensitive. I avoid formulas with unnecessary fillers, artificial colors, or harsh additives. I also look for supplements that are easy on my stomach and designed to be taken with meals. If a product causes burning, nausea, or discomfort, I stop using it.
5. I Consider Whether I Need Probiotics or Not
Some digestive supplements combine enzymes with probiotics. I’ve found that this can be helpful for some people, but not always for me. If my main issue is breaking down food, I focus first on enzymes and bile support. If I want broader gut support, then I consider a formula with probiotics too.
6. I Look for Third-Party Testing
Because I want quality and safety, I check whether the supplement has been tested by an independent lab. This gives me more confidence that what’s on the label is actually in the bottle. It also helps me feel better about consistency and purity.
7. I Match the Supplement to My Meals
I’ve found that my needs change depending on what I eat. For heavier, fattier meals, I do better with a stronger formula that includes bile support. For lighter meals, a basic enzyme blend may be enough. I try to choose a supplement that fits my eating habits rather than using a one-size-fits-all product.
8. I Watch for My Body’s Response
My body gives me the best feedback. If I feel less bloated, have fewer stomach issues, and digest meals more comfortably, I know I’m on the right track. If I notice side effects like cramping, diarrhea, or reflux, I reassess the formula and dosage.
9. I Read Labels Carefully
I always read the label before buying. I look for clear ingredient lists, serving size, and directions for use. I also check whether the product is meant to be taken before or during meals, since timing matters for digestive support.
10. I Ask My Doctor If I’m Unsure
Because everyone’s situation is different, I don’t assume a supplement will work the same for everyone. If I have ongoing digestive problems or take other medications, I talk to my doctor before trying a new product. That gives me extra peace of mind.
